“Giving Away” the Panama Canal: A Deceptive Narrative
One in every of Trump’s extra persistent claims considerations the US “giving freely” the Panama Canal to Panama. This declare, typically voiced with a tone of dismay or remorse, must be examined fastidiously. The reality, as with many historic occasions, is considerably extra nuanced.
The truth will not be so simple as a unilateral act of generosity. The switch of the canal was a course of spanning many years, culminating in a collection of treaties that fastidiously addressed the pursuits of each the US and Panama. The inspiration of the canal’s eventual handover was laid by the Torrijos-Carter Treaties, signed in 1977. These treaties, the results of years of negotiations, outlined a phased switch of management of the canal. Underneath these agreements, the US retained management and operations of the canal till the top of December within the yr 1999. At the moment, the Panama Canal was transferred to Panama, marking the top of the U.S.’s direct involvement in its operations.
The treaties weren’t merely a present. Panama gained sovereignty over the canal zone, an space that had beforehand operated below U.S. management. In change for the canal, Panama additionally secured important monetary compensation and provisions designed to strengthen its nationwide financial system. Critically, the treaties additionally ensured the canal’s neutrality, guaranteeing its continued entry for ships of all nations. Thus, the switch wasn’t a easy “giveaway;” it was a fancy settlement balancing competing nationwide pursuits and aimed toward fostering a extra steady and equitable relationship between the 2 nations. The settlement additionally offered protections for the US, making certain that its ships would proceed to take pleasure in entry to the canal, making certain continued financial advantages. Due to this fact, whereas it’s true that the canal transitioned to Panamanian management, to explain it as merely “giving it away” is a simplification that misrepresents the complicated historic and political context.
Constructing the Canal: A Story of Labor and Legacy
One other frequent assertion facilities on the US’ position in constructing the Panama Canal. Whereas the U.S. undoubtedly accomplished the canal, the narrative typically neglects the essential preliminary efforts and the tragic realities of its building.
The story of the Panama Canal begins lengthy earlier than the U.S. involvement. Within the late nineteenth century, the French, below the management of Ferdinand de Lesseps, the builder of the Suez Canal, tried to assemble the canal. Nevertheless, their efforts had been stricken by illness (primarily yellow fever and malaria), engineering challenges (tough terrain and soil circumstances), and corruption, leading to substantial monetary losses and a excessive demise toll among the many staff. Their efforts had been in the end deserted. The French expertise highlights the intense problem of the venture.
The US bought the French belongings and took up the problem. This involvement meant using a brand new strategy, incorporating progressive engineering methods, and, most significantly, addressing the devastating well being issues. Crucially, the U.S. employed an enormous public well being marketing campaign, below the steering of Dr. William Gorgas, which centered on eradicating mosquitoes, the first vectors of yellow fever and malaria. This effort, together with important developments in engineering and building, was a significant factor in the US’ success in finishing the canal.
The truth additionally includes the large human price. Hundreds of laborers, together with Afro-Caribbean staff, confronted harmful circumstances and sometimes deadly sicknesses. They had been subjected to pressured labor in circumstances that may be thought-about unacceptable by trendy requirements. The development of the canal was an costly venture, by which the human price by way of demise and struggling was excessive, demonstrating the need for acknowledging the complete historic context. Whereas it’s true that the U.S. accomplished the canal, the narrative of its building has typically downplayed the important position of the preliminary French effort, the huge public well being and engineering challenges, and the large human price of its building.
